    Apr 23, 2014 · Jewels are often the best thing to socket in an item. Their best benefits are resistances, Increased Attack Speed, and damage, both physical and elemental.The bonuses you get to mana and hit points and many other things are nice also, but are less than you can get from gems or common Runes.. The real benefit of jewels is that they can give their bonus from items that gems and runes don't.

    At ilvls 1-30, there's a 40% chance of 1 affix and a 20% chance each of 2, 3 or 4 affixes. At ilvls 31-50, there's a 60% chance of 2 affixes and a 20% chance each of 3 or 4 affixes. At ilvls 51-70, there's an 80% chance of 3 affixes and a 20% chance of 4 affixes. At ilvls 71+, there's a 100% chance of 4 affixes.

    Aug 20, 2005 · You can reroll any MAGICAL item with 3 perfect gems in your cube. You can reroll any RARE item with 6 perfect skulls in your cube (it'll lower the quality though, you can up the quality but the recipe involves wasting a soj) You can't reroll any UNIQUE/SUPERIOR items. You can reroll runewords by unsocketing the item and placing new runes in it.

    The ilvl of a Crafted Item is equal to half the level of the crafting character (rounded down) plus half the ilvl of the input item (rounded down). Put another way: (1) ilvl = int(.5 * clvl) + int(.5 * ilvl) The ilvl calculated in (1) has to undergo two checks and possible modifications. First, ilvl is capped at 99: (2) if ilvl > 99 then ilvl = 99
